Warning Signs You Need Dehumidification Services

Catching these signs early can save you thousands of dollars in repairs and prevent bigger problems down the line. Keep an eye out for: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, unpleasant smells can be a sign of excess moisture in your walls or floors. If the odors persist, it’s time to call in a professional.

Water Stains or Warping on Walls and Floors

Visible signs of water damage or warping on your walls and floors show that moisture has been present for an extended period. Addressing the issue quickly is crucial.

Mold Growth in Hidden Areas

Mold can grow in hidden areas, such as behind walls or under flooring. Ignoring these signs can lead to serious health risks and costly repairs.

Unusual Sounds or Creaks in Your Home

Unusual sounds or creaks in your home can show moisture-related issues, such as warped flooring or settling foundations.

Visible Signs of Water Damage on Ceilings

Water stains or warping on your ceilings can be a sign of a larger moisture issue. Don’t delay in addressing the problem.

High Humidity Levels in the Summer

Summer humidity can be a breeding ground for moisture-related issues. Keep an eye on your humidity levels and take action if they become too high.

Dehumidification Services v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water spill in a contained area Yes No DIY is fine for small, contained areas where the damage is minimal.
Visible signs of water damage or warping on walls and floors No Yes Visible signs of water damage or warping show a more complex issue that needs professional expertise.
High humidity levels in the summer No Maybe High humidity levels can be addressed with DIY solutions, but if the issue persists or worsens, it’s best to call a professional.
Mold growth in hidden areas No Yes Mold growth in hidden areas poses serious health risks and needs professional attention.
Water damage in multiple areas or rooms No Yes Water damage in multiple areas or rooms shows a more extensive issue that needs professional expertise and equipment.

Dehumidification Services Cost In Fairwood, WA

The cost of Dehumidification Services can vary greatly depending on the severity and size of the affected area. Estimates can range from $500 to $2,500 or more, depending on the complexity of the job. Our team will provide a detailed estimate after inspecting your property and developing a customized plan to address the issue.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Initial Inspection and Assessment $100 – $300 Size of affected area, complexity of the issue
Dehumidification Equipment Rental $200 – $1,000 Duration of rental, type of equipment needed
Specialized Cleaning and Disinfecting $300 – $1,500 Size of affected area, type of materials involved
Final Inspection and Review $100 – $300 Size of affected area, complexity of the issue

Keep in mind that these estimates are based on average costs and may vary depending on the specifics of your situation. Our team will provide a detailed estimate after inspecting your property and developing a customized plan to address the issue.

Common Questions About Dehumidification Services

Will I need to replace my carpets or flooring?

Not always. In many cases, our team can salvage your existing carpets and flooring by drying and cleaning them thoroughly. But, in severe cases, replacement may be necessary to ensure safety and prevent further damage.

How long will the dehumidification process take?

The length of time depends on the severity and size of the affected area. Typically, our team can complete the process within 3-5 days, but in some cases, it may take longer. We’ll provide a detailed timeline after inspecting your property.

Is dehumidification a one-time fix?

Unfortunately, moisture-related issues can be recurring. To prevent future problems, we recommend regular maintenance and inspections to ensure your property remains moisture-free.

Will I need to evacuate my home during the process?

In most cases, no. Our team will work with you to reduce disruptions and ensure a safe working environment. But, in extreme cases, we may recommend temporary relocation to ensure your safety and the effectiveness of the process.

Can I prevent mold growth and moisture damage?

Yes! Regular inspections, maintenance, and addressing moisture-related issues quickly can go a long way in preventing mold growth and moisture damage. Our team can provide guidance on how to maintain a moisture-free home.
